TechTarget Inc.

NASDAQ: TTGT · Real-Time Price · USD
6.82
0.02 (0.29%)
At close: Jun 20, 2025, 3:59 PM
6.91
1.32%
After-hours: Jun 20, 2025, 07:01 PM EDT

TechTarget Statistics

Share Statistics

TechTarget has 71.49M shares outstanding. The number of shares has increased by 150.29% in one year.

71.49M
150.29%
0%
83.02%
29.82M
3,487
0.89%

Short Selling Information

The latest short interest is 1.31M, so 1.83% of the outstanding shares have been sold short.

1.31M
1.83%
4.49%
5.27

Valuation Ratios

The PE ratio is 558.37 and the forward PE ratio is 3.49. TechTarget's PEG ratio is -5.84.

558.37
3.49
10.83
0.9
11.17
43.05
-5.84
Financial Ratio History

Enterprise Valuation

TechTarget has an Enterprise Value (EV) of 2.7B.

11.72
142.89
37.18
46.59

Financial Position

The company has a current ratio of 10.04, with a Debt / Equity ratio of 1.93.

10.04
10.04
1.93
22.86
7.45
-0.09

Financial Efficiency

Return on Equity is 2% and Return on Invested Capital is -0.11%.

2%
0.64%
-0.11%
$109,506.19
$2,124.29
2,100
0.33
n/a

Taxes

9.96M
69.06%

Stock Price Statistics

The stock price has increased by -78.01% in the last 52 weeks. The beta is 1.15, so TechTarget's price volatility has been higher than the market average.

1.15
-78.01%
7.77
17.98
40.37
392,519

Income Statement

In the last 12 months, TechTarget had revenue of 229.96M and earned 4.46M in profits. Earnings per share was 0.06.

229.96M
139.9M
-2.27M
4.46M
18.86M
-2.27M
0.06
Full Income Statement

Balance Sheet

The company has 226.67M in cash and 431.16M in debt, giving a net cash position of -204.5M.

226.67M
431.16M
-204.5M
84.83M
732.97M
367.18M
Full Balance Sheet

Cash Flow

In the last 12 months, operating cash flow was 72.49M and capital expenditures -14.63M, giving a free cash flow of 57.85M.

72.49M
-14.63M
57.85M
0.81
Full Cash Flow Statement

Margins

Gross margin is 60.84%, with operating and profit margins of -0.99% and 1.94%.

60.84%
-0.99%
6.27%
1.94%
8.2%
-0.99%
25.16%

Dividends & Yields

TTGT does not appear to pay any dividends at this time.

n/a
n/a
n/a
n/a
0.18%
2.32%
Dividend Details

Analyst Forecast

The average price target for TTGT is $13.5, which is 97.9% higher than the current price. The consensus rating is "Buy".

$13.5
97.9%
Buy
6
Stock Forecasts

Fair Value

There are several formulas that can be used to estimate the intrinsic value of a stock.

$0.31
-95.45%
2.09
-69.35%

Scores

1.71
4